Tithe was a tax on all agricultural land originally a tenth of the produce excepting only church lands and glebes and urban areas and it was paid by leaseholders and occupiers of all religious denominations to the clergy of the established church of ireland. Ian woodward falconer born august 25, 1959 is an american author and illustrator of childrens books, and a designer of sets and costumes for the theater.

Kim falconer born 23 may 1954 in santa cruz, california is an australian author of ya and adult speculative fiction, living in new south wales.
